Subject: Now we can ALL share MIDI files
From: Alan of Australia
Date: 23 Oct 99 - 11:06 AM

G'day,

I suppose it's about 2 years ago that I wrote MIDItext, a way of converting simple MIDI files into text, and back again, for Mudcatters to use in this forum. (The red text that you see in some threads.)

This seems to have filled a need, however not every mudcatter has been able to use it, particularly Mac users.

Now that it's possible to take advantage of free web space, I've created a site for MIDI files not yet in the Digital Tradition.

If you have a tune to post to a thread, email the MIDI file to me, Alison or Joe Offer & it will be quickly available for downloading.

MIDItext is still available of course, but it should be considered to be superseded by this web page.

 

Check it out here.

Advantages:

Users of operating systems other than microsoft can access the MIDIs.

So could people who are currently scared off by MIDItext.

We can share complicated MIDIs, including changing time signatures.

MIDIs remain easily accessible after the thread has disappeared into oblivion.

There's enough space to hold the entire Mudcat collection of midis if they are fairly simple with the occasional complicated one, although the main purpose would be to hold the ones not yet in the DT.

Disadvantage:

No ABC. There is good support available for ABC though at the ABC home page, including programs for converting between ABC and MIDI.
